Title: Your Ultimate Guide to a 5 Night 6 Days Trip to Riyadh, Saudi Arabia







Riyadh, the capital city of Saudi Arabia, is a city filled with history, culture, and traditions. If you are planning a trip to Riyadh, here is your ultimate guide to make the most of your 5 night 6 days trip.



Day 1: Arrival in Riyadh

You will land at King Khalid International Airport and be greeted by your guide. After checking in at your hotel, visit the iconic Kingdom Tower, which gives you a breathtaking view of the city. In the evening, head towards Al-Masmak Fort, one of the oldest and most historic forts in the city. Finish the day with a delicious dinner at Najd Village, a traditional Saudi Arabian restaurant where you can enjoy local food.



Day 2: Explore the culture and traditions of Riyadh





Start the day by visiting the King Abdulaziz Historical Center, where you will learn about the history of Saudi Arabia. The center includes a museum, library, and a mosque. After the King Abdulaziz Historical Center, visit the Al Murabba Palace, a stunning palace located in the heart of Riyadh. In the evening, take a stroll around the historical Deira Souq, where you can shop for traditional Arabian souvenirs, spices, perfumes, and more.



Day 3: Visit Masmak Fortress and National Museum

Begin the day with a visit to the historic Masmak Fortress, which is a symbol of the beginning of the unification of Saudi Arabia. After visiting the Fortress, head towards the National Museum, one of the most prestigious museums in Saudi Arabia. You will gain insight into the history of the kingdom and its customs and traditions.



Day 4: Trip to Diriyah

A trip to the old city of Diriyah is a must-do. The UNESCO World Heritage site was once the capital of the first Saudi state, from 1744-1818. Visit the Diriyah Museum and Al Turaif, a palace complex that was once the hub of political and administrative activities in the kingdom. Take a stroll under the palm trees and enjoy traditional Arabian coffee and dates.







Day 5: Excursion to Edge of The World

On your fifth day, embark on an exciting adventure to the edge of the world, where you can witness the majestic cliff that overlooks the breathtaking desert of Riyadh. This spot has been gaining in popularity due to its picturesque, unique and natural scenery.



Day 6: Departure from Riyadh

The last day of your trip will include a visit to the magnificent Al Faisaliah Tower, a shopping and business centre with a sky bridge and restaurants on the top floor. After enjoying lunch with a view, it will be time to say goodbye to Riyadh and head back home.
